Subject: [PATCH 1/5] refs.[ch]: remove unused ref_storage_backend_exists()
Date: Tue, 28 Sep 2021 15:02:20 +0200	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<patch-1.5-7a252061b51-20210928T130032Z-avarab@gmail.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<cover-0.5-00000000000-20210928T130032Z-avarab@gmail.com>

This function was added in 3dce444f178 (refs: add a backend method
structure, 2016-09-04), but has never been used by anything. The only
caller that might care uses find_ref_storage_backend() directly.
